Born: 27 January 1826 in L'Acadie, Lower Canada
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Julienne married Edouard MARCHAND 3 November 1846 in Saint-Valentin, Canada East .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Edouard MARCHAND was born 8 December 1822 in L'Acadie, Lower Canada . Edouard died 13 April 1901 in Tilbury, Ontario, Canada. Edouard was the child of Pierre MARCHAND and Marie-Louise PLANTE.
Julienne GIROUX died 16 November 1882 in Tilbury, Ontario, Canada.

Québec Place Names Through History
Québec has been described by several names during different periods of its history. Knowing the period name can make older records easier to recognize.
- Early 1600s–1760
- Canada, New France
- 1760–1763
- Canada
- 1763–1791
- Province of Québec
- 1791–1867
- Lower Canada
- 1867–present
- Québec, Canada
